Bexleyheath Station is well-equipped with facilities designed for a smooth and accessible travel experience.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with a ticket office open from Monday to Saturday until 20:00 and slightly reduced hours on Sunday. For those collecting tickets bought online, accessible machines are available in the station forecourt. The station embraces modern ticketing with smartcards issued and validated here.
The station boasts full step-free access, making it easy for those with mobility needs to navigate. Although there are 83 parking spaces available, including four accessible ones, bear in mind that parking equipment here isn't fully adapted for accessibility needs. While the station lacks luggage storage and accessible toilets, other conveniences like payphones, a coffee kiosk, and a newspaper stand are present. Secure storage for 32 bicycles is available, though hiring services are not a facility at this station. Remember, CCTV offers peace of mind in various areas, ensuring safety during your visit.
For onward travel, Bexleyheath Station efficiently connects you with local bus services and rail replacement options. If a journey toward Lewisham or Dartford is in your plans, make use of bus stops BF and BH respectively on Pickford Lane. At Merstham station, securing your travel tickets is a breeze. The ticket office is open from 06:10 to 19:35 from Monday to Saturday and on Sundays from 08:30 to 16:40. For your convenience, there are also ticket machines available, including those specifically designed to acc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Additionally, smartcard facilities are available, ensuring you're all set for a hassle-free journey.
Should you require assistance, help points are conveniently located throughout the station. Staff are on hand to offer support during designated hours throughout the week. Although there is no luggage storage, be assured that CCTV coverage is in place to enhance security within the premises.
Merstham station strives to be accessible to all passengers. While step-free access is available, the routes can vary, and it's advisable to check maps or contact the station staff for the best routes to suit your needs. Assistance can be pre-booked, or you can take advantage of the turn-up-and-go service, which facilitates spontaneous travel options.
For onward travel from Merstham station, you'll find various transport options that ensure you remain connected. Taxis can be easily accessed outside Platform 1, while local bus services are also available with helpful information on routes provided at the station. In the event of any service disruptions, a rail replacement service ensures your journey is uninterrupted.
